Coming Home & Newborn Care Consultation

Personalised support to live the first weeks with your baby with more peace of mind, and find your new bearings as a family.

Coming home from the maternity ward marks the beginning of a new stage. Between discovering your baby, daily care, family organisation and the many adjustments of the first weeks, it is normal to have questions and to need time to gain confidence.

This consultation gives you personalised time to take stock of daily life with your baby, answer your questions and support you through this transition into your new family life.

This consultation can help you:

  • Gain confidence in the everyday care and handling of your baby
  • Go back over advice or practices covered during your maternity stay
  • Better understand your newborn’s needs and their first rhythms
  • Adapt your family organisation to this new stage of life
  • Answer your questions about the first weeks with your baby
  • Revisit your birth experience, if you feel the need to talk about it

Support that complements your perinatal care

This consultation complements the follow-up provided by the professionals of your perinatal journey (midwife, doctor, paediatrician, paediatric nurse…). It offers dedicated time for the questions of daily life with your baby, for understanding their needs and for building confidence as new parents.

When a situation calls for specific care, you will naturally be referred to the most suitable healthcare professional.

FAQ

When should I book this consultation?

You can book this consultation as soon as you come home from the maternity ward, and at any point during the first weeks after the birth.

Does this consultation replace a visit from a midwife or the PMI (maternal and child health service)?

No. It complements your medical follow-up by supporting you with the practical side of daily life with your baby.

Can I book this consultation even if I have not attended the Prep’Classes?

Yes. This consultation is open to every family, whether or not they have taken the Renésens Prep’Classes.
